Web11 mrt. 2012 · According to the organization ‘Cantine Scolaire’, 6 million French children eat lunches at the cantine every day. Who is responsible for managing school cantines? Municipal governments are responsible for pre-school and school lunches. Often, schools have a built-in kitchen and dining room. Web6 mrt. 2024 · It's a good idea to eat at least five servings of fruits and vegetables every day, so try to fit in one or two at lunch. A serving isn't a lot. A serving of carrots is ½ cup or about 6 baby carrots. A fruit serving could be one medium orange. Know the facts about fat.
